Output 5ee838fcea2ecf5c4d7858d61f0b643ae3a77ec6d058322bf65af0a9e61a22ca:0

value
1406973246
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85ff26570be2b131b564fd999c70cd360e263a73 OP_EQUAL
address
3DuXTB2dtoBNPb3bbv3xxspb6dU8jx7NVw
transaction
5ee838fcea2ecf5c4d7858d61f0b643ae3a77ec6d058322bf65af0a9e61a22ca
spent
true